Yesterday, the 8th District Court of Appeals refused to grant prosecutors in the Holliman case a stay of Common Pleas Judge Eileen Gallagher's order requiring the prosecutors to turn over virtually their entire investigatory file to the defense. A newsnet5.com article on the Court's order indicates that the order does not contain the court's reasoning, and states that but for 7 pages of notes, some case law and a folder with victim statements, the Judge has already allowed defense attorneys to sift through a box of evidence under the watchful eye of her staff.
